HB4617

COMMON INTEREST COMMUNITY REG

Introduced·1/27/26
Introduced Text

Establishes the Office of Common Interest Community Registration to oversee common interest community associations.

The Office of Common Interest Community Registration Act creates the Office within the Division of Real Estate in the Department of Financial and Professional Regulation. The Office will require common interest community associations to register, pay a fee, and provide documents. It can investigate complaints, issue fines, and refer violations to authorities. The Act also creates the Community Interest Community Registration Fund and repeals the Condominium and Common Interest Community Ombudsperson Act.
